高碘对大鼠甲状腺血清激素水平及NIS基因表达的影响

Effect of high iodine on serum hormone level and NIS gene expression in rats thyroid

【摘要】 目的观察高碘对大鼠甲状腺血清激素水平及NIS基因表达的影响。方法选取健康Wistar大鼠40只,随即分成4组,分别为正常组(NI)、10倍高碘组(10HI)、50倍高碘组(50HI)、100倍高碘组(100HI)各10只,饲养3个月后称取甲状腺质量,检测血清甲状腺激素水平和甲状腺组织中NIS mRNA表达水平。结果各HI组大鼠甲状腺相对质量与绝对质量与NI组比较差异无统计学意义(P>0.05);10HI组、50HI组血清激素TT4、FT4、TT3水平与NI组比较差异无统计学意义(P>0.05);100HI组血清激素TT4、FT4、TT3水平均低于NI组,50HI组和100HI组FT3水平均低于NI组,差异均有统计学意义(P<0.05);各HI组与NI组NIS mRNA表达水平比较有所下降,但差异无统计学意义(P>0.05)。结论过量的碘摄入可使大鼠血清甲状腺激素水平和NIS mRNA的表达水平发生变化,从而可能引发某些甲状腺疾病。

【Abstract】 Objective To investigate the effects of high iodine on serum hormone level and NIS gene expression in rats thyroid.Methods Forty healthy Wistar rats were randomly divided into 4 groups:normal group(NI),10 times high iodine group(10 HI),50 times high iodine group(50 HI),100 times high iodine group(100 HI),each of 10 rats.The thyroid weight was measured after feeding for 3 months,the levels of serum thyroid hormone and the expression of NIS mRNA in thyroid tissue were detected.Results There was no significant difference in the relative mass and absolute mass of thyroid between each HI group and NI group(P>0.05).There were no significant differences in serum hormones TT4,FT4,TT3 between 10 HI group and 50 HI group compared with NI group(P>0.05).The serum levels of TT4,FT4 and TT3 in 100 HI group were lower than those in NI group;The FT3 levels in 50 HI group and 100 HI group were lower than those in NI group,the difference was statistically significant(P<0.05).The expression levels of NIS mRNA in each HI group and NI group were decreased,but the difference was not statistically significant(P>0.05).Conclusion Excessive iodine intake can change the level of serum thyroid hormone and the expression of NIS mRNA in rats,which may lead to the occurrence of certain thyroid diseases.
